slfjambo Posted July 4, 2008 Share Posted July 4, 2008 Driver to hold talks over future Driver scored five goals for Hearts last season Andrew Drivers' agent will meet with Hearts officials next week to discuss the winger's future following summer interest from other clubs. Burnley have rejected suggestions that they are about to make a third offer for the 20-year-old likely to be in the region of ?1m. But Scott Fisher told BBC Sport: "I will be speaking to Hearts next week." A Burnley spokesman said: "We can categorically state there has been no fresh bid for Andrew Driver." Burnley's Scottish manager, Owen Coyle, recently said that he would wait for further contact from Hearts after having a second bid rejected. Meanwhile, Hearts captain Christophe Berra set aside renewed speculation linking him with a move to Wolverhampton Wanderers to praise the side's pre-season preparations. Hearts have yet to appoint a new manager after a fruitless summer search. But Berra told the Scottish Premier League club's website: "I've been three or four seasons and this is one of the hardest pre-season's we've done.
